Common Causes of a Bleach-Like Vaginal Smell

There are several reasons why you might notice a bleachy or chemical odor in your vagina. Some of the most common causes include:

1. Vaginal pH Imbalance

A disrupted vaginal pH can lead to abnormal odors, including a bleachy smell. This imbalance often results in conditions like bacterial vaginosis (BV), causing strong, unpleasant odors.

2. Hormonal Changes

Hormonal fluctuations, particularly during menstruation, pregnancy, or menopause, can alter vaginal discharge and cause a temporary bleach-like odor, which usually resolves once hormones stabilize.

3. Infections

Infections, such as bacterial vaginosis or yeast infections, can result in a bleachy vaginal odor due to an overgrowth of harmful bacteria disrupting the healthy vaginal microbiome.

4. Discharge Changes

Changes in discharge color, consistency, or odor (such as a bleachy smell) may signal an infection or imbalance in the vaginal microbiome. Look for other symptoms like irritation or itching.

Is a Strong Vaginal Odor a Sign of Infection?

A sudden, strong vaginal odor, particularly one that smells like bleach or ammonia, could be a sign of an infection. Conditions such as bacterial vaginosis, trichomoniasis, or a yeast infection can cause these types of odors. If you notice a persistent or unusual smell, it’s important to see a doctor for a diagnosis and appropriate treatment.

When Should You See a Doctor for Vaginal Smell?

If the bleach-like vaginal odor persists, is accompanied by unusual discharge, or is causing discomfort, it’s important to consult a healthcare professional. They can perform tests to identify the cause of the odor and provide treatment options, such as antibiotics for bacterial infections or antifungal medications for yeast infections.
